David Horvitz
Eighty ways to steal a book

The artists’ book How to shoplift books by David Horvitz is a guide on how to steal books. It details 80 ways in which one can steal a book, from the very practical, to the witty, imaginative and romantic. Originally published in 2013, this paperback reissue is making the sought after title available again at an affordable price (for those who don’t yet know the techniques described within) and is released in multiple languages.

This is the Australian edition, Eighty ways to steal a book.

This publication originated in 2011 as a conversation in The Classroom at Printed Matter's NY Art Book Fair. The Classroom is a series of informal events organised by David Senior.
